Output fcecb8c752b2605f8ae870d0e3599150dccfe804ed9f835da069d594ede6924a:1

value
10964461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b61c469a60898c3efcf88beebcc1f7983e44f8 OP_EQUAL
address
MEFm1vTgN56C7Tsn7GcNcGA38SpJAJr1ae
transaction
fcecb8c752b2605f8ae870d0e3599150dccfe804ed9f835da069d594ede6924a
spent
true